## Crash Pipeline Setup

Clone `marlette-crashd`, run `make deps`, then `make ingest-local`. The Pebbledash mobile app posts crash bundles to port 7741; symbolication runs inline. Verify with `curl localhost:7741/health` before tagging a release. Dedup hashing requires the symbol cache to be warm—run `make warm-symbols` once per branch. Retention is 14 days locally. The ingest worker writes parsed reports to the reports database, connecting with the string shown below.

primary connection of kahof-kagep = mssql://belath_svc:3uqY4g6LHG5Nyi@db-d0ba.ferralabs.corp:5432/rusdor

Handover: Paylark retry logic. Idempotency keys are now generated client-side per checkout attempt and stored in the ledger cache for 48 hours. If a retry arrives with a seen key, the gateway returns the cached response instead of re-charging. Watch for key collisions from the Vexton mobile client — it reuses keys after app restarts. Mitigation steps and the dedupe query live on the internal page below.

runbook for badug-kadup: https://confluence.zemvarlabs.internal/projects/browse/display/projects/bd1b

Facilities ticket — Night shift, Brindlecote Campus. Twenty-two interns from the Fennhollow programme arrive tomorrow at 08:00. Please unlock seminar rooms B2 and B3 by 06:30, set chairs to classroom layout, and confirm the water coolers on level one are refilled. Leave the loading bay clear for their equipment van. Overnight access to the prep corridor requires the pass code below.

badge for bajop-yawep: bdg-NNHEW-6

## Authentication

The Ledgerpane audit-log viewer authenticates to the internal TrailStore service using a single API key supplied via the `X-Trail-Key` header. The key is read-only and scoped to audit partitions; it cannot write or delete entries. Keys are rotated on a 30-day schedule by the platform team. For reviewing the staging deployment, the current read-only key is provided below.

service key, tadup-tahog: zpat7_wB1tnEL

Subject: Quickstore 4.2 — bloom filter now fronts the KV layer

Plugin authors: starting with this release, Quickstore places a bloom filter ahead of the key-value store. Negative lookups return faster; false positives fall through safely. No API changes are required on your side. Verify your plugin against the staging build referenced below.

session token of fahif-tadup = htk3_9c7